The Significance Of Measuring Innovation

I can identify at the very least three the reason why measuring innovation is essential.

First and foremost, metrics promote habits. For instance, an organization would possibly determine to calculate and monitor income and revenue generated from new merchandise or take a look at what share of recent tasks are hitting their targets. As a consequence, groups will likely be extra targeted on serving to new tasks succeed and winding up the underperforming ones promptly.

Second, metrics for innovation can perform as a stethoscope or a glucose monitor to assist diagnose an underlying situation or spot a development. For instance, if there are few submissions on an open innovation portal regardless of quite a few visits to the webpage, reviewing the figures recurrently can assist to establish any bottlenecks.

Third, metrics are helpful to assist replicate on and justify the exercise’s existence. If a program manages to assist the diffusion of a know-how, succeeds in attracting promising startups, or produces ROI producing concepts, it’s most likely sensible to proceed. In the absence of fine output metrics, justifying the funding turns into arduous.

Four Steps To Deciding On And Deploying Higher Metrics 

Step 1: Understand And Doc The Specifics Of Your Exercise

Ignorance is likely to be bliss in some circumstances, however positively not in the case of managing your company innovation program. The extra you realize, the extra focused your strategy could be. 

Your innovation exercise (almost certainly a program) is exclusive in its make-up. It has its personal goal or purpose and its particular goal or addressee group(s). It might be led by a selected perform in your group (usually procurement, R&D, advertising, or HR) and is designed to facilitate a novel sort of information trade or move (insights, concepts, proposals, new contacts and so forth.).

Finally, there’s a very particular set of things motivating the goal group to trade info with you and a delegated authorized framework to make sure that what you might be transacting stays secure.

Before creating a listing of metrics, doc these particularities and ask your self:

  • How is my exercise or program just like others in my group/market/{industry}?
  • How is my exercise or program dissimilar to others in my group/market/{industry}?
  • What is the forecasted timeframe for the exercise?
  • What outcomes would we prefer to see inside this timeframe?
  • What main forces affect the exercise?
  • Who are an important stakeholders and what’s our relationship to them?

Use these inquiries to have an trustworthy and knowledgeable dialogue about your targets and the individuality of your engagement and to establish some anchor factors. Chances are that somebody has already tried what you wish to try to has documented the method and outcomes.

Step 2: Think In Ranges Or Layers

As you begin placing collectively a listing of related metrics, let the reference stage information you. Start by eager about the top targets and the way these targets trickle down the group. Next, search for methods to gauge your progress with these targets on the nationwide/interorganizational (macro), organizational (mezzo), division/crew (micro), and particular person (nano) ranges. Here are some examples of typical targets and metrics that organizations, consortia, and even nations are : 

Level: National/supranational

Sample purpose: Strengthening the nationwide or regional innovation/ startup ecosystem. 

Possible metrics:

  • Number of incubators, open laboratories, and accelerators on a territory
  • Digital literacy ranges
  • Number of college spin-offs per area or nation
  • Patents granted; patents per million inhabitants
  • Number of Nobel Prizes awarded per million inhabitants
  • Share of R&D bills in GDP and progress of R&D expenditure

Level: Interorganizational

Sample purpose: Strengthening ecosystem of companions in a given {industry}

Possible metrics:

  • Diversity of the collaborative association (newcomers versus incumbents, European versus Asian entities, intra- versus inter-industry participation)
  • Number of companions (and/ or associate turnover) over a given time interval
  • Number of joint tasks created over a given time interval (optionally, whole undertaking worth)
  • Number of joint on-line and offline occasions efficiently organized over a given time interval (optionally, attendance stage or contact time)
  • Knowledge switch depth, e.g., the variety of paperwork being collectively reviewed, shared, utilized and so forth.

Level: Organizational

Sample purpose: Become essentially the most revolutionary group within the nation/area/{industry}

Possible metrics:

  • Number of printed patent functions
  • Number of granted patents, emblems, or copyrights
  • Consumers’ notion of innovation (in a given firm)
  • Diffusion of personal innovation methodologies (are your collaborators utilizing your frameworks?)
  • Revenue from new merchandise, companies, enterprise fashions
  • Total variety of new merchandise, companies, enterprise fashions launched in a yr

Level: Team or division

Sample purpose: Change tradition of the R&D division in an effort to turn out to be an {industry} chief

Possible metrics:

  • Number of department-specific concepts or contributions over a time frame (what’s the measurement of the pipeline? How has it developed over time?)
  • Diversity of contributors and of contributions (are all of them incremental innovation concepts? Do most submitters share the identical background?)
  • Efficiency and efficacy of the crew
  • Teamwork high quality: group cohesion, steadiness of member contributions, means to coordinate
  • Team reflexivity
  • Task orientation

Level: Individual

Sample purpose: Promote innovation habits/construct confidence in innovation strategies

Possible metrics:

  • Individual variations (does the person possess any attributes that assist innovation? Are they motivated?)
    • Personality dimensions
    • Motivation
  • Job traits (does the work surroundings of the person assist innovation?)
    • Job complexity
    • Autonomy on the job
    • Internal local weather at group
    • Resources and relationship with supervisor
  • Number of innovation-related contact factors or interactions in a month (has this worker actively participated in innovation occasions? Have they mastered a brand new ability?)
  • Number of inquiries (is that this particular person reaching out proactively?)

 Another means to consider metrics is by part.

In the early setup, you would possibly contemplate enter metrics: variety of new inside insights collected, variety of innovation actions, variety of concepts posted, and so forth. Next, as this system matures, you would possibly incorporate throughput metrics. Companies take a look at the velocity of testing their hypotheses, velocity of recent functionality acquisition, quantity or ratio of staff and leaders conversant in innovation or NPD methods, time to revenue, engagement ranges, and extra.

Finally, in well-established packages, output metrics may present a sign of how a lot the innovation is contributing to the enterprise. To this finish, we would take a look at the make-up of the pipeline (what number of concepts per horizon), variety of carried out concepts, quantifiable change in habits, variety of new companions, ROI, value financial savings, and so forth.).

Step 3: Simplify It

One of the frequent pitfalls innovation professionals routinely fall into is the complexity lure. Designing a dashboard of metrics in your program could be overwhelming and also you is likely to be tempted to maintain including info to it. However, remember that not all that we are able to measure, we are able to (actively) handle.

Innovation is essentially a human-centric pastime and it’s our process to grasp the methods by which people who represent the innovation engine are “predictably irrational.” Factor this facet into your strategy to measuring a program, a crew, or a person’s efficiency. 

In brief, and along with studying up on behavioral economics, do your greatest to maintain it easy. Select 5 to seven key metrics to start with, describe them, make them seen, and begin accumulating some knowledge. Consistency right here is vital, as is the commentary that no measurement system is ready in stone. Our process is to essentially perceive the strengths and weaknesses of the innovation exercise in scope and to design an ample intervention to right the course. Here are some inquiries to information you: 

  • Have I chosen the best metrics for the purpose I take note of?
  • Have I chosen essentially the most related metrics?
  • Can I reliably carry out these measurements? Do I’ve the correct definitions, frameworks, databases, software program, and instruments to seize, retailer, and interpret knowledge?
  • Have I knowledgeable these related to the measurement process? For instance, the groups whose efficiency I’d like to spice up or the members of this system that I’d prefer to increase.
  • When will I revisit the metrics? Monthly/quarterly/yearly?

Step 4: Document Your Progress And Use Each Useful Resource You’ve Gotten

Do you utilize software program in your innovation administration efforts? Even generic enterprise software program can assist you monitor your program’s well being and perceive the place it is likely to be failing. When you ship out messages to your employees, test the open charge. When you invite folks to go to/take part in a brand new marketing campaign/channel, test the variety of guests or variety of inquiries obtained. When you might be launching a name for proposals, perceive the demographics of the contributors. Built-in metrics are extraordinarily helpful and may function a place to begin.
